Pigat被动信息收集聚合工具

一、简介

Pigat被动信息搜集聚合工具,该工具经过爬取目的URL在第三方网站比方备案查询网站、子域名查询网站的结果来对目的停止被动信息搜集。该工具在2020年3月21日更新至2.0版本,该版本采用Scrapy框架开发,协程处置,运转速度更快,并且支持文件导出功用,同时修复了多个Bug,增加了多个功用。开发此工具的初衷就是平常在运用一些第三方的网站停止目的信息搜集的时分,常常需求应用多个网站停止目的信息的搜集,比方经过在线的Whois信息查询网站、在线的CMS信息查询网站、目的在Shodan上的信息等等,如此一来,就会增加很多反复的工作量,因而便开发了此工具,将平常常用的网站聚合到一个工具里。

下载地址:https://github.com/teamssix/pigat

二、装置过程

1、复制到本地装置包

git clone https://github.com/teamssix/pigat.git

图片[1]-Pigat被动信息收集聚合工具-孤勇者社区

2.装置pip3

下载
wget https://bootstrap.pypa.io/get-pip.py

图片[2]-Pigat被动信息收集聚合工具-孤勇者社区

装置pip3
python3 get-pip.py

查看版本
pip -V

图片[3]-Pigat被动信息收集聚合工具-孤勇者社区

3、装置需求的模块
pip3 install -r requirements.txt

图片[4]-Pigat被动信息收集聚合工具-孤勇者社区

三、用法

格式:

python3 start.py -u your_url

阐明:

-u 指定要被动搜集的url
-o 导出被动搜集结果,支持 CSV、JSON、XML 等格式,结果将保管到 ./output 目录下
-a 直接被动搜集一切结果,没有步骤提示,并默许导出 result.csv 文件
-h 查看协助

 

示例:

python3 start.py -u teamssix.com                    被动搜集 teamssix.com 结果并显现
python3 start.py -u teamssix.com -a                 直接被动搜集 teamssix.com 一切结果并显现,同时默许导出 result.csv 文件
python3 start.py -u teamssix.com -o output.csv      被动搜集 teamssix.com 结果并显现,同时导出 output.csv 文件
python3 start.py -u teamssix.com -o output.csv -a   直接被动搜集 teamssix.com 一切结果并显现,同时导出 output.csv 文件

1、python3 start.py -u xxx.com

 被动搜集备案信息
 被动搜集 Whois 信息
 被动搜集子域名信息
 被动搜集子域名 IP 信息
 被动搜集子域名 CMS 信息
 被动搜集子域名 Shodan 信息
 被动搜集子域名破绽信息
 
图片[5]-Pigat被动信息收集聚合工具-孤勇者社区

2、选择要要执行的编号

 

------本页内容已结束,喜欢请分享------

感谢您的来访,获取更多精彩文章请收藏本站。

© 版权声明
THE END
喜欢就支持一下吧
点赞13赞赏 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情代码图片